Developed by a coalition of San Diego civic leaders and educators, High Tech High opened in September 2000 as a small public charter school with plans to serve approximately 450 students.  HTH has evolved into an integrated network of sixteen charter schools serving approximately 6,350 students in grades K-12 across four campuses.

 

Located in San Diego County, California, High Tech High (HTH) is guided by four connected design principles—equity, personalization, authentic work, and collaborative design—that set aspirational goals and create a foundation for understanding our approach. HTH seeks an Elementary Education Specialist to serve as essential support to meet the needs of students with disabilities in the general education setting.

 

JOB SUMMARY

 

Education Specialists provide assessment services and,  if needed,  develop,  implement,  and supervise  Individualized  Education  Plans  (IEPs). In collaboration with classroom teachers and parents/guardians, Education Specialists support and monitor student progress towards IEP goals, and play a crucial role in communicating needs, services, and accommodations to staff and  parents/guardians.

 

Duties include:

 

●      Provide individuals instruction and support to students with special needs in a general education setting

●      Support general education teachers by developing related goals and objectives, planning, and implementation strategies to meet the needs of students with IEPs

●      Provide accommodations for students with individual needs to encourage learning and success

●      Identifies and supports students’ social, emotional and behavior learning needs

●      Implements Project-based Learning techniques and strategies

●      Facilitates and designs effective group work amongst students

●      Fosters student growth through semi-annual Student-led Conferences (SLC) and Presentations of Learning (POL)

●      Scaffolds instructional activities that facilitate engaging and appropriate learning opportunities

●      Creates relevant and authentic learning experiences

●      Provides opportunities for student engagement through “Voice and Choice”

●      Implements backward design to align all lessons, activities and assessments

●      Designs formal and informal assessments that measure student progress
